Selena Gomez revealed a special surprise from fiancé Benny Blanco when she arrived home after the Emmy awards on Sunday.
The actress, 33, received a glowing welcome when she got home. The record producer, 37, had placed dozens of candles around their pool.
A photo shared on social media shows her standing by the display, looking glamorous, with outstretched arms.
Gomez, who stunned on the red carpet in a custom made red Louis Vuitton gown, changed in to a gray Louis Vuitton gown and switched her hair from the sweet ponytail she’d worn at the awards ceremony to a sleek bun.
Other snaps show the Love On singer celebrating the show’s nominations with co-stars Richard Fine and Michael Cyril Creighton and members of the crew who had been up for awards.
Only Murders in the Building received seven nominations, including Outstanding Comedy Series, but lost to newcomer The Studio.

It’s believed her next big production will be her wedding to Blanco.
The pair have done their best to keep details of their big day private.
When promoting the new season on Only Murders on The Tonight Show Starring Jimmy Fallon earlier this month, Gomez quipped Short might have a special job in the ceremony.
After Martin joked about not having received his invitation, Fallon put the actress on the spot and asked if her co-stars had been invited.
